Dothraki

Etymology

From Proto-Plains *mai (mother).

Pronunciation

IPA(key): /ˈmai/

Rhymes: -ai

Noun

mai (animate, plural maisi)

  1. mother, mom
Inflection
Singular Plural
Nominative mai maisi
Accusative mayes
Genitive maisi
Allative maisaan maisea
Ablative maisoon maisoa
